Your computer comes preloaded with a number of applications that many people won’t use but that can eat up system resources. … WebMay 6, 2024 · To fix this in Windows 10, press the Windows key, and then type (and select) Task Manager. When the Task Manager opens, click the “Startup” tab. Here, you’ll see all the programs that are set to turn on when Windows boots up. Take a look at the column on the far right labeled Startup Impact.

WebDec 23, 2024 · 2. Disable Start-Up Programs. Another way to speed up Windows 11/10 is to disable start-up programs. In most cases, many Desktop computers and laptops come with pre-installed start-up programs that are fully operational. Adding more applications may reduce your Windows 11/10 operational speed.
